WebStep 5 Removing the key. Push the pick right and down from its top. This should pull the edge of the keycap up. Make sure not to push the pick to the left (inwards, under the key) yet. If you push the pick left too early, it will end up under the scissor clip. Add a comment. WebTo remove the “normal” keys, use a thin, flat tool such as a pair of tweezers or a small screwdriver to get under the key at the bottom-left corner and push the prong out of its hole. Once it’s out, pull the key down from the top-right corner and wiggle until the left hand side of the key is detached. WebTo start, turn off your Mac and unplug it from the power source.
